Large Motor / Pump Vibration Trips

Excessive vibration in a motor/pump is symptomatic of a problem that can cause further damage or deterioration. If ignored, the results are higher maintenance and downtime. In some situations, it could also lead to safety concerns.

Vibration sensors or accelerometers can be installed to detect abnormal vibration levels. Alarm trips can monitor the vibration sensors and provide a local trip source for the motor. These pumps can be installed in many different environments so Class I, Div 2/Zone 2 certification and wide ambient temperature specs for these alarm trips are key characteristics.

If necessary, the vibration levels can also be retransmitted back to the control system using the Analog Output signals from the alarm trips.

Shown in the diagram above is the STA Functional Safety Limit Alarm Trip logic solver which is IEC61508 certified. If the loop isn’t part of a safety instrumented system (SIS) where a standard alarm trip will do, then the SPA2 Programmable Limit Alarm Trip would be a great alarm trip choice.
